Eurostar EV97

Evektor teamEurostar
On Friday 24th, November 2006 the Evektor delivered the 500th piece of its worldwide popular advanced ultra light airplane teamEurostar. The Eurostar with serial number 20062904 was handed over to Mr Karl-Heinz Augustin from Germany at Evektor production facility. It’s my honour to become owner of the 500th teamEurostar which has been enjoying worldwide success. I have chosen this airplane for its uncompromising build quality, reliability and outstanding flight characteristics." Mr Karl-Heinz Augustin said.

By the end of this year Evektor is going to overrun number of 700 manufactured airplanes including also Light Sport Aircraft SportStar and teamEurostar predecessor P220UL Koala. Today's production rate exceeds 150 airplanes annually that are exported to 40 countries worldwide.

TeamEurostar production was launched in 1997 when the airplane received the Czech type certificate followed by certifications in Germany, Belgium, Italy, United Kingdom, France, Finland, Spain and other countries. The strictest European certification - the UK BCAR«s - the Eurostar passed in 2001 and in the following 3 years became the best selling advanced microlight on the UK market; in 2003 the airplane was voted as The aircraft of the year by the readers of UK Pilot magazine. In 2005 the teamEurostar became the very first type certified airplane in the new Ecolight category in Switzerland. For its excellent flight characteristics, reliability and all metal airframe durability the airplane became very popular also in flight schools for pilot training and glider towing. Recently the airplane was delivered to Pilot Training Centre of the Czech Army for initial army pilots training.

Evektor is one of the world’s largest Light Sport Aircraft and advanced UL aircraft manufacturer with deliveries to over 40 countries worldwide; in present the company has in certification process the advanced four seat single VUT100 Cobra and has been developing also the new generation utility twin engine turboprop EV-55 Outback for transportation of 9 to 14 passengers or cargo
